Missional Calling Course Outline

- The missional calling of the church Level 5, Credits 7
- Missional calling of the church
- The concept of the missional calling of the church
- Transformations in the way the missional calling of the Church is understood
- The unfinished task of the church
- Principles and methods executing the missional calling of the church
- Basic principles and methods of evangelism
- Basic principles and methods of church planting
- Basic principles and methods involved in the fresh expressions movement
- Basic principles and methods of community involvement as response to the missional calling
- Discipleship as way of fulfilling the missional calling
- The power of establishing and developing a humble, Christ-like presence in communities
- The pro-active and reactive service role and responsibility of the church in society
- Principles and methods of research and conducting social analysis (determining the strengths and needs in society)
- The principles of providing compassionate service in the community
- The principles of community development from a Christian perspective
- Focus areas in community development (specific challenges)
- Social justice, advocacy and policy
- Christian visions and understanding of Biblical justice
- Principles, practices and processes of prophetic witness
